The SAFMC has determined that the commercial and rercreational fishery for Gag Grouper in the South Atlantic Federal waters will end at 12:01 AM (local Time) on October 23, 2023. It will re-open May 1, 2024.

Why This Closure is Happening:
The final rule for Amendment 53 to the Fishery Management Plan for the Snapper-Grouper Fishery of the South Atlantic Region, which revises and reduces the commercial and recreational catch limits for gag, will be effective on October 23, 2023.

For the 2023 fishing year, the gag commercial catch limit will be 85,326 pounds gutted weight. Reports indicate that commercial landings have reached the 2023 revised commercial catch limit. The accountability measure requires commercial harvest to close when the commercial catch limit has been reached. This closure is necessary to protect the gag population.

For the 2023 fishing year, the gag recreational catch limit will be 90,306 pounds gutted weight. Reports indicate that recreational landings have reached the 2023 revised recreational catch limit. The accountability measure requires recreational harvest to close when the recreational catch limit has been reached. This closure is necessary to protect the gag population.

During the Closure:
Sale or purchase of any gag harvested in or from federal waters is prohibited.
The prohibition on sale or purchase does not apply to gag that were harvested, landed ashore, and sold before 12:01 a.m., (local time) October 23, 2023, and were held in cold storage by a dealer or processor.

The bag and possession limits for gag in or from South Atlantic federal waters are zero.

The restrictions on the bag and possession limits for gag and the prohibition on sale or purchase apply in the South Atlantic on board a vessel for which a valid Federal commercial or charter vessel/headboat permit for South Atlantic snapper-grouper has been issued, without regard to where such species were harvested, i.e., in state or Federal waters.

Commercial harvest for the 2024 fishing year in South Atlantic federal waters will open at 12:01 a.m., (local time,) on May 1, 2024, unless otherwise specified.

Recreational harvest for the 2024 fishing year in South Atlantic federal waters will open at 12:01 a.m., (local time,) on May 1, 2024, unless otherwise specified.
